Strategy for weight loss or weight gain

PART A: Scientific Information

Step 1:
Get to know the 3 major components in Total Energy Expenditure.

1

Basal Metabolic Rate (BMR) 

Accounting for approximately 65-70% 

A measure of the calories required for maintaining normal body functions such as:

  • respiration
  • blood circulation
  • renal processing 
  • gastrointestinal

Influential factors:

  • 70-80% of the difference among individuals contributed by
    • Fat-free mass ⚠️= Lean Muscle Mass
  • Other factors include
    • age
    • nutrition status
    • genetics
    • differences in endocrine functioning (such as hypo- or hyperthyroidism)
2

Physical Activity

Typically 20-30%

Most variable among individuals of all the components.

The number of calories expended through physical activity increases with the:

  • frequency
  • intensity
  • duration of the training program 
  • as well as non-training daily activity
    • washing a car, doing housework etc.
3

Diet-induced Thermogenesis
= thermic effect of food

Approximately 10-15% of total calories burned daily.

The thermic effect of food includes the:

  • energy cost of digestion
  • absorption
  • metabolism
  • storage of food in the body

Step 3⃣️:

Use metabolic equivalents (MET values) — an estimate of caloric expenditure during activity. 
One MET corresponds to an energy expenditure of 1 kcal/kg/hour. 
Greater the intensity of exercise, the higher the MET value.
🧮Online Calculator: https://metscalculator.com

⚠️Example:
IF Mildred’s body weight is 50kg. When she participate in 1MET activity, will expend 50 calories in one hour.
IF she select to run in 8km/h pace, will eventually expend 50 (kg)*8.3 (=MET) = 415 calories in one hour.

Metabolic Equivalent of Task (MET) 代謝當量ActivityIntensity
1⚠️example Sitting quietly
3Resistance traininglow-medium intensity
3.5Home exercise / Body weight exerciseslow-medium intensity
3.5Walking (horizontal ground)~4.5-5.2km/h
4.3Walking (horizontal ground)~5.6km/h
5Walking (horizontal ground)~6.4km/h
5Ellipticalmedium intensity
6Resistance traininghigher intensity
6.8Bicycle (fixed power 90-100W)low intensity
8Circular training, Body weight exerciseshigh intensity
8.3⚠️example Walk quickly~8km/h
8.8Bicycle (fixed power 101-160W)medium intensity
9Running~8.5km/h
9.8Running~9.7km/h
10.5Running~10.8km/h
11Bicycle (fixed power 161-200W)high intensity
